Resources for the Pope's Upcoming Visit to the U.S.Pope Benedict XVI recently announced plans to make his first papal visit to the U.S., with April stops in Washington and New York. The Pew Forum has resources to help put this event in its historical, political and religious contexts.
Survey: U.S. Public Opinion about Pope Benedict XVI
A September survey found that the pontiff is viewed favorably by nearly three-quarters (73%) of those familiar enough to offer an opinion.

Analysis: Pope Visits 'Pentecostalized' Brazil
In May, when the pope visited the world's most Catholic country, he also encountered a nation fast becoming one of the world's most pentecostal countries.
